Hemingway ended “Who Murdered the Vets?” with the final questions, “Who left you there? And what’s the punishment for manslaughter now?” The first question was officially answered privately behind the closed doors of politicians. The second went unanswered. No person was ever formally charged with the neglect of the veterans.
